Radio Waves - MM Issue 1102 - 28th August 2003

Not Only But Also!

Holly O'Halloran with camera

Not only is Holly O'Halloran a popular 3MGB teenage presenter, ( Teen Spirits Saturday 2 - 4pm and Unknown Sunday 5 - 7pm) but she has recently revealed that she is also a very talented visual artist. Holly, together with Raf Sands and Jim Hilvert-Bruce, is a finalist in the Photography section of the Gippsland Diegesis Festival, a celebration of achievements in video, photography, digital animation and web site design. Encouraged by Mallacoota P-12 College Arts Teacher Nigel Allison, the three students successfully submitted work from their year 11 folio to the festival. We wish them great success as we await the outcome of the awards.

Margaret Stevenson Returns!

After enjoying a wonderful trip across the top end of Australia, Margaret Stevenson will return to the airwaves next Tuesday at 10am to present Genoa Gold. Margaret has presented Genoa Gold over many years, bringing to the community an amazing collection of jazz recordings. She has had a fantastic holiday and is eager to get back into the chair. Margaret is a past president of 3MGB and valued contributor to the station. Welcome back Margaret, we look forward to hearing your dulcet tones on air once again!
